Description
Summary:The article presents a case of ergonomic intervention proposing the physiological preparation of workers as a tool for the prevention of musculo-skeletal disorders in the agri-food sector. In a business whose activities have strong organizational and physiological constraints, the leverage to introduce this kind of practice is questioned. The implementation of warm-ups within a company requires, on the one hand, to have both ergonomic and physical preparation skills. On the other hand, a specific social construction of the intervention would be asked for. Finally, the conditions for success of the project both from the point of view of the stakeholders and the company should be laid beforehand to ensure the success of the overall prevention process.
